Every little thing You Required to Know Concerning Roof Covering Services: Professional Setup, High Quality Services, and Preventive Maintenance Roof solutions play a crucial role in keeping the honesty of any type of home. From professional setup to quality fixings and preventative maintenance, these facets are necessary for safeguarding buildings. https://roofingcompaniesaustin68878.wikipresses.com/6496795/explore_the_key_benefits_of_commercial_roofing_riverside_for_contemporary_businesses